Market focus : Indonesia

  • Thursday 08 December 2022 17:00-19:30
  • CCIG, bd du Théâtre 4, Genève
  • Organisation : Embassy of the Republic of Indonesia and CCIG in collaboration with Switzerland Global Entreprise

 

Logos%208.12

This seminar, co-organized by the Embassy of the Republic of Indonesia to Switzerland and Liechtenstein and CCIG with the help of Switzerland Global Entreprise, aims to provide Swiss entrepreneurs with commercial, legal and logistical keys to approaching the Indonesian market.
